Meaning of Olle
Descendant, forefather's heir.
Origin of Olle
The name 'Olle' has its origins in Sweden, where it is a diminutive form of the name Olof. Olof itself is derived from the Old Norse name Áleifr, which is composed of the elements 'anu', meaning 'ancestor', and 'leifr', meaning 'heir' or 'descendant'. Therefore, the name 'Olle' can be understood to mean 'descendant of the ancestors' or 'heir of the ancestors'. This name has a deep connection to Swedish culture and heritage.

Earliest Known Use of Olle

The earliest known use of the name 'Olle' dates back to the 18th century in Sweden. It has been a popular name in the country ever since, and its usage has spread to other parts of the world as well.

Etymology of Olle

The etymology of the name 'Olle' is rooted in the Old Norse language, which was spoken by the Vikings. The combination of the elements 'anu' and 'leifr' creates a name that reflects the importance of ancestral heritage and lineage in Norse culture.
